When I mouse over the icon it says "search". I *think* the icon was for an email client that I used to use and recently uninstalled, Mailbird. Right clicking on the icon does nothing. The icon is not visible in taskbar settings.

It sounds like you are experiencing a situation where an icon for a previously uninstalled email client, Mailbird, is still present in your taskbar. This can happen sometimes if the uninstallation process does not fully remove all traces of the program.

To resolve this issue, here are a few steps you can try:

1. Restart your computer: Sometimes, a simple restart can help resolve minor software glitches and clear any residual icons or processes.

2. Check the system tray settings: Right-click on an empty space in the taskbar and select "Taskbar settings." Scroll down to the "Notification area" section and click on "Select which icons appear on the taskbar." Look for the Mailbird icon in the list and make sure it is toggled off. If it is not present in the list, proceed to the next step.

3. Use the Task Manager: Right-click on the taskbar and select "Task Manager." In the Processes tab, find any processes related to Mailbird and end them by selecting "End task." This should terminate any running instances of Mailbird and potentially remove the associated icon.

4. Clear icon cache: The taskbar icons are stored in a cache, and if there is any corruption in the cache, it can cause lingering icons to appear. To clear the icon cache, follow these steps:
- Press the Windows key + R to open the Run dialog box.
- Type the following command and press Enter: `cmd /c del %userprofile%\AppData\Local\IconCache.db /a`
- Restart your computer for the changes to take effect.

5. Reinstall and uninstall Mailbird again: If none of the above steps have resolved the issue, you can try reinstalling Mailbird, then uninstalling it again using the official uninstallation method. This can help ensure that any remaining files or settings are properly removed.

If the problem persists after trying these steps, it may be worth contacting Mailbird's support team for further assistance, as they may have specific guidance on how to resolve this particular issue.
